/*
|
|
* PCI address
|
|
* bit 16 - 24: bus number
|
|
* bit 8 - 15: devfun number
|
|
* bit 0 - 7: offset in configuration space of a given pci device
|
|
*/
|
|
|
|
/* the helper function to get a PCIDevice* for a given pci address */
|
|
static inline PCIDevice *pci_dev_find_by_addr(PCIBus *bus, uint32_t addr)
|
|
{
|
|
uint8_t bus_num = addr >> 16;
|
|
uint8_t devfn = addr >> 8;
|
|
|
|
return pci_find_device(bus, bus_num, devfn);
|
|
}
|
|
|
|
static void pci_adjust_config_limit(PCIBus *bus, uint32_t *limit)
|
|
{
|
|
if ((*limit > PCI_CONFIG_SPACE_SIZE) &&
|
|
!pci_bus_allows_extended_config_space(bus)) {
|
|
*limit = PCI_CONFIG_SPACE_SIZE;
|
|
}
|
|
}
|
|
|
|
static bool is_pci_dev_ejected(PCIDevice *pci_dev)
|
|
{
|
|
/*
|
|
* device unplug was requested and the guest acked it,
|
|
* so we stop responding config accesses even if the
|
|
* device is not deleted (failover flow)
|
|
*/
|
|
return pci_dev && pci_dev->partially_hotplugged &&
|
|
!pci_dev->qdev.pending_deleted_event;
|
|
}
|
|
|
|
void pci_host_config_write_common(PCIDevice *pci_dev, uint32_t addr,
|
|
uint32_t limit, uint32_t val, uint32_t len)
|
|
{
|
|
pci_adjust_config_limit(pci_get_bus(pci_dev), &limit);
|
|
if (limit <= addr) {
|
|
return;
|
|
}
|
|
|
|
assert(len <= 4);
|
|
/* non-zero functions are only exposed when function 0 is present,
|
|
* allowing direct removal of unexposed functions.
|
|
*/
|
|
if ((pci_dev->qdev.hotplugged && !pci_get_function_0(pci_dev)) ||
|
|
!pci_dev->has_power || is_pci_dev_ejected(pci_dev)) {
|
|
return;
|
|
}
|
|
|
|
trace_pci_cfg_write(pci_dev->name, pci_dev_bus_num(pci_dev),
|
|
PCI_SLOT(pci_dev->devfn),
|
|
PCI_FUNC(pci_dev->devfn), addr, val);
|
|
pci_dev->config_write(pci_dev, addr, val, MIN(len, limit - addr));
|
|
}
|
|
|
|
uint32_t pci_host_config_read_common(PCIDevice *pci_dev, uint32_t addr,
|
|
uint32_t limit, uint32_t len)
|
|
{
|
|
uint32_t ret;
|
|
|
|
pci_adjust_config_limit(pci_get_bus(pci_dev), &limit);
|
|
if (limit <= addr) {
|
|
return ~0x0;
|
|
}
|
|
|
|
assert(len <= 4);
|
|
/* non-zero functions are only exposed when function 0 is present,
|
|
* allowing direct removal of unexposed functions.
|
|
*/
|
|
if ((pci_dev->qdev.hotplugged && !pci_get_function_0(pci_dev)) ||
|
|
!pci_dev->has_power || is_pci_dev_ejected(pci_dev)) {
|
|
return ~0x0;
|
|
}
|
|
|
|
ret = pci_dev->config_read(pci_dev, addr, MIN(len, limit - addr));
|
|
trace_pci_cfg_read(pci_dev->name, pci_dev_bus_num(pci_dev),
|
|
PCI_SLOT(pci_dev->devfn),
|
|
PCI_FUNC(pci_dev->devfn), addr, ret);
|
|
|
|
return ret;
|
|
}
|
|
|
|
void pci_data_write(PCIBus *s, uint32_t addr, uint32_t val, unsigned len)
|
|
{
|
|
PCIDevice *pci_dev = pci_dev_find_by_addr(s, addr);
|
|
uint32_t config_addr = addr & (PCI_CONFIG_SPACE_SIZE - 1);
|
|
|
|
if (!pci_dev) {
|
|
trace_pci_cfg_write("empty", extract32(addr, 16, 8),
|
|
extract32(addr, 11, 5), extract32(addr, 8, 3),
|
|
config_addr, val);
|
|
return;
|
|
}
|
|
|
|
pci_host_config_write_common(pci_dev, config_addr, PCI_CONFIG_SPACE_SIZE,
|
|
val, len);
|
|
}
|
|
|
|
uint32_t pci_data_read(PCIBus *s, uint32_t addr, unsigned len)
|
|
{
|
|
PCIDevice *pci_dev = pci_dev_find_by_addr(s, addr);
|
|
uint32_t config_addr = addr & (PCI_CONFIG_SPACE_SIZE - 1);
|
|
|
|
if (!pci_dev) {
|
|
trace_pci_cfg_read("empty", extract32(addr, 16, 8),
|
|
extract32(addr, 11, 5), extract32(addr, 8, 3),
|
|
config_addr, ~0x0);
|
|
return ~0x0;
|
|
}
|
|
|
|
return pci_host_config_read_common(pci_dev, config_addr,
|
|
PCI_CONFIG_SPACE_SIZE, len);
|
|
}
